Davide Pellegrini is Professor of Marketing in the Department of Economics and Management at the University of Parma where he is also coordinator of Executive Programs and Post Degree Courses in Retail and Distribution Management. He holds a PhD - Bocconi University, Milan - and is visiting professor at the universities of Kobe – Japan -, Nancy – France- and Zaragoza –Spain. In 2009, he was consultant for Iftech, the Japanese Institute for Future Technology. In 2011, he was awarded the Ordre des Palmes Academiques in Strasbourg. His research interests include marketing metrics, vertical relationships, competitive regulation and public policies. His work has been presented at international conferences, including those held by the Journal of the Academy of Marketing Science and by ESCP/EAP.

The New Social Game: Sharing economy and digital revolution: An insight on consumers' habits change. E-book. Formato EPUB Davide Pellegrini   -  Egea, 2019  - 

"The idea of BlaBlaCar was born one Christmas when I wanted to get home to my family in the French countryside. 500 km away from Paris, it wasn’t the easiest place to reach. With no car and all the trains sold out, I finally convinced my younger sister to make a lengthy detour via Paris to pick me up. By the end of 2016, BlaBlaCar will count 40 million members in 22 countries. In the past decade, enabled by trust and technology, we have built the world’s largest carpooling community. We have turned millions of lonely drivers into carpoolers and have opened up a whole new world of friendly and affordable travel. We are optimizing cars, one of the world’s most inefficiently used assets. And best of all, we are enabling new social connections along the way.” Frédéric Mazzella – Founder of BlaBlaCar

Channel metrics. E-book. Formato PDF Davide Pellegrini   -  Egea, 2021  - 

Il volume propone i passaggi algebrici per formulare e comprendere le simulazioni necessarie a controllare i risultati delle azioni di marketing nelle filiere del largo consumo. I destinatari di questo libro sono i marketing manager, gli analisti delle imprese industriali e commerciali e gli studenti dei corsi di laurea specialistici in marketing e trade marketing e dei master. Il testo raccoglie spunti di ricerca nella frontiera del marketing metrics: in particolare analizza gli strumenti necessari a far sì che la metrica di tutti i giorni possa essere consolidata in serie storiche e proiettata in simulazioni. I capitoli 6, 8, 10 sono a cura di Gianpaolo Costantino di SymphonyIRI Group.
